Sometimes I come across things and wonder how it’s possible that I haven’t yet heard of them. Enter Wish Upon a Hero. This website was featured on the front page of the Newark Star Ledger today, and with good reason. The site exists for people to post their wishes, and others to help grant them.
This online community operates under the ideal that “No wish (is) too large and no hero too small” – and everyone is encouraged to help anyone. It’s an excellent opportunity to make a difference in the lives of others, with real needs.
Getting on here and helping each other out is stuff for everyday heroes. Take a peek at the site and see if it’s a good fit for your philanthropic selves!
